blueAPACHE is an Australian information technology managed service provider (MSP) and IT-as-a-Service (ITaaS) provider founded in 1998. The company delivers enterprise-focused IT solutions[buzzword] through its emPOWER reference architecture, offering consumption-based services to mid-market organisations in Australia and internationally.[1]
blueAPACHE was founded in July 1998 by Chris Marshall in response to a shortage of IT standards and competencies in the Australian SME market.[2] The company began as a managed IT services provider and later expanded into consumption-based ITaaS offerings enabled by its emPOWER architecture.[3]
blueAPACHE’s operations centre around the emPOWER reference architecture, which provides scalable access to Managed Services, Connectivity, Cloud, Collaboration, Security, and Advisory Services as a monthly consumption-based solution.[4] The company supports mid-market organisations with infrastructure, telecommunications, and cloud service delivery across multiple geographic regions.
